Photo by Carl Recine/Getty Images Lamine Yamal had to receive a painkiller injection in order to play against Inter Milan in the UEFA Champions League, according to the Catalan press. Officially, no one from FC Barcelona has confirmed this, and outside observers would find the news surprising given how well he played. It’s known that during warm-ups, Yamal seemed to sense pain and went back for a medical test, before finally coming back to play the game.

Photo by Mattia Ozbot - Inter/Inter via Getty Images Inter Milan star Lautaro Martínez had to leave the match against FC Barcelona with an injury, and reports in Italy say he could miss the return - or even the rest of the season. But, with tests yet to be carried out, all scenarios are on the table... even that he could play in the semifinal second leg. Martínez is one of Inter’s best players, and manager Simone Inzaghi surely would rather have him available if possible.

Photo by Pablo Rodriguez/Quality Sport Images/Getty Images Ahead of Saturday’s Copa del Rey Final against Barcelona, Real Madrid’s official TV channel (RMTV) released a critical video targeting referee Ricardo de Burgos Bengoechea, who will officiate the match. RMTV’s practice of harsh critiques against referees has been called into question in the past, by those who see it as an attempt to try to influence the match or put pressure on the ref before it gets started.
